When you install Chrome on Mac, you automatically get access to Chrome DevTools with the browser. Licensed as proprietary freeware, Chrome uses the Apple WebKit rendering engine for iOS versions. Google Chrome is preferred by two-thirds of browser users across platforms, securing that position by serving as a major platform of compatibility for web apps, and should not be confused for Chrome OS which is an operating system. Google Chrome for Mac is widely popular because it offers Google-specific features on your Mac.ĭownload Google Chrome on your Mac to get a multi-functional web browser that’s easy to use and customize, no matter your skill level. Because Google has used parts from Apple's Safari and Mozilla's Firefox browsers, they made the project open source. It utilizes very fast loading of Web pages and has a V8 engine, which is a custom built JavaScript engine.
Its final version is slated to go live in fall.Google Chrome is a Web browser by Google, created to be a modern platform for Web pages and applications. People can now start trying the beta version of the macOS High Sierra. According to the same statement, "APFS makes common operations such as copying files and directories instantaneous, helps protect data from power outages and system crashes and keeps files safe and secure with native encryption."
With that, developers and content creators can now build 3D and VR materials on a macOS High Sierra computer.Īpple also introduced the Apple File System as one of the new features on the macOS High Sierra.
In a statement, Federighi said: "macOS High Sierra delivers important forward-looking technologies and new opportunities for developers wanting to tap into the power of machine learning and create immersive VR content on the Mac."Īlongside the macOS High Sierra, Apple has also introduced an upgrade to their graphics-focused application programming interface called Metal 2, which primarily brings the needed tool so Mac computers with macOS High Sierra can run VR contents. Meanwhile, the macOS High Sierra has also been upgraded to support virtual reality contents and will introduce the new Apple File System. The said security updates will also restrict autoplaying video ads on websites.
The macOS High Sierra will be equipped with a tool that can prohibit ad trackers from prying on the user's online activities without their knowledge. Alongside a faster performance, the Safari will also get security upgrades.
The upcoming Mac software update also adds support for virtual reality contents and a new file management system.Īpple's Senior Vice President of Software Engineering, Craig Federighi, presented the macOS High Sierra at the Worldwide Developers Conference on Monday.ĭuring the macOS update's introduction, the Apple executive reportedly shared that High Sierra's Safari is equipped with a JavaScript that will enable it to run much faster than the mentioned web browser. The upcoming macOS High Sierra promises to make Safari run 80 percent faster than Google Chrome.
